WWE
World Wrestling Entertainment (WWE), a professional wrestling force, has evolved into a diversified entertainment behemoth. World Wrestling Entertainment is owned by TKO Group Holdings, a division of Endeavour Group Holdings, and its impact is seen well outside of the wrestling arena.
Established in 1953 as the Capitol Wrestling Corporation (CWC), WWE’s journey has been marked by strategic transformations. Originally a Northeastern territory of the National Wrestling Alliance, it later became the World Wide Wrestling Federation (WWWF) in 1963.
The shift to World Wrestling Federation (WWF) occurred in 1979, and in 2002, after a legal dispute with the World Wildlife Fund, the company adopted its current name, World Wrestling Entertainment.
World Wrestling Entertainment has demonstrated its worldwide media and entertainment reach with its forays into movies, football, and other economic endeavours. In addition to wrestling, the corporation expands its reach by licencing its intellectual property for action figures and video games.

The promotion boasts the largest global audience in professional wrestling, with flagship events like WrestleMania captivating millions. WWE’s main roster is divided into Raw and SmackDown, complemented by the developmental roster NXT. The company’s global headquarters in Stamford, Connecticut, is supported by offices worldwide, showcasing its international influence.
In a significant turn of events in 2023, World Wrestling Entertainment explored a potential sale amidst an employee misconduct scandal involving Vince McMahon, its majority owner.
The merger with Zuffa, the parent company of UFC, under TKO Group Holdings, marked a new chapter, completing on September 12, 2023. McMahon, now the executive chairman, and Nick Khan, the president, lead the newly formed entity, reflecting WWE’s resilience and adaptability in the face of change.

Is WWE real or scripted?
WWE matches are scripted and choreographed for entertainment purposes. While the outcomes are predetermined, the physicality and athleticism involved can pose real risks to performers.
